Representative of Zelensky: We will revive the 90s and achieve the exit of all subjects from the Russian Federation
Ukraine launched a systemic process of secession from the Russian Federation by all entities that declared their independence after the collapse of the USSR.
The representative of the President of Ukraine in the Verkhovna Rada, Fyodor Venislavsky, stated this at a briefing, as reported by the PolitNavigator correspondent.

“We acted in full compliance with the norms of international law, recognizing the Republic of Chechnya-Ichkeria as an independent entity from the Russian Federation , a completely independent sovereign subject of international relations.
We can also extend this to other subjects of the Russian Federation, namely to those that, firstly, have their own nationality or nationality, that live compactly within the borders of a certain territory, and these are the key features that give these subjects the right to self-determination , to create national statehood.
In the 90s, when the USSR ended its existence, in addition to 15 republics that exercised their right to self-determination of national statehood, there were a number of other subjects, in particular the Russian Federation, which also proclaimed their declarations of state sovereignty,” said the representative Zelensky.
He emphasized that virtually any constituent entity of the Russian Federation has the right to self-determination.
“Moreover, those entities that proclaimed their statehood in the 90s have the absolute right to achieve this statehood, to demand and achieve through their actions.
Therefore, this decision of the Verkhovna Rada, the Rada’s appeal to international institutions, to other states, it can, and we are confident that it founded a very long and consistent systemic process of secession from the Russian Federation by entities that have such a right, according to the UN Charter,” Venislavsky said .
